condor_ history
View log of condor jobs completed to date
condor_ history
[-help] [-l] [-f filename]
[-constraint expr | cluster | cluster.process | owner]
condor_ history displays a summary of all condor jobs listed in the
specified history files. If no history files are specified (with the -f option), the local
history file as specified in Condor's configuration file
( condor/spool/history by default) is read. The default listing
summarizes each job on a single line, and contains the following items:
- ID
- The cluster/process id of the condor job.
- OWNER
- The owner of the job.
- SUBMITTED
- The month, day, hour, and minute the job was submitted to the queue.
- CPU_USAGE
- Remote user CPU time accumulated by the job to date in days, hours, minutes, and seconds.
- ST
- Completion status of the job (C = completed and X = removed).
- COMPLETED
- The time the job was completed.
- PRI
- User specified priority of the job, ranges from -20 to +20, with higher numbers corresponding to greater priority.
- SIZE
- The virtual image size of the executable in megabytes.
- CMD
- The name of the executable.
If a job ID (in the form of cluster_id or cluster_id.proc_id) or an
owner is provided, output will be restricted to jobs with the
specified IDs and/or submitted by the specified owner.
The -constraint option can be used to display jobs that satisfy a
specified boolean expression.
- -help
- Get a brief description of the supported options
- -f filename
- Use the specified file instead of the default history file
- -constraint expr
- Display jobs that satisfy the expression
- -l
- Display job ads in long format
condor_ history will exit with a status value of 0 (zero) upon success,
and it will exit with the value 1 (one) upon failure.
